How Three-Dimensional Tank Washing Nozzles Work

Three-dimensional tank washing nozzles are high-performance cleaning devices that achieve thorough cleaning through high-pressure water flow and a specially designed nozzle structure. Their core mechanism includes:

  • High-Pressure Water Flow Drive: Cleaning liquid is pumped into the nozzle at high pressure, generating a powerful water stream. The water's reactive force drives the nozzle’s rotation.
  • Three-Dimensional Rotational Spray: The nozzle rotates simultaneously in both horizontal and vertical directions, creating a complex cleaning trajectory that covers all interior surfaces of the tank.
  • Multi-Nozzle Design: Some models are equipped with multiple nozzles positioned at different angles, allowing for simultaneous multidirectional spraying and further improving cleaning efficiency.
  • Optimized Cleaning Trajectory: Utilizing precision gear reduction systems and advanced mechanical structures, the nozzle follows a preset trajectory to ensure uniform cleaning fluid distribution, eliminating blind spots and ensuring complete tank coverage.

Key Advantages of Three-Dimensional Tank Washing Nozzles

Designed for maximum efficiency and cleanliness, three-dimensional tank washing nozzles offer several key benefits that enhance performance and sustainability.

  • Dead-End-Free Cleaning: The dynamic rotation and multiple spray angles guarantee thorough coverage, eliminating residues in corners and crevices.
  • High Efficiency: The optimized jetting pattern significantly reduces cleaning time, minimizing operational downtime.
  • Water and Resource Savings: Compared to traditional cleaning methods, rotary nozzles use less water and cleaning agents while maintaining superior results.
  • Eco-Friendly Solution: Reduced water and chemical usage contribute to sustainable and environmentally friendly cleaning processes.

Comparison with Traditional Cleaning Methods

Unlike traditional static nozzles or manual cleaning methods, which often leave blind spots and require significant time and resources, three-dimensional tank washing nozzles offer several advantages:

  • Complete Coverage: Traditional methods may miss hard-to-reach areas, while three-dimensional nozzles ensure every surface is cleaned.
  • Time Efficiency: The high-pressure, multi-angle jetting pattern significantly reduces cleaning time compared to manual scrubbing or static nozzles.
  • Resource Conservation: Less water and cleaning agents are required, making the process more sustainable and cost-effective.
